Naval News – Belgium’s long-running plan to replace its ageing M-class frigates has entered a new and potentially consequential phase. Defence Minister Theo Francken has publicly stated that the joint Dutch-Belgian frigate programme is moving “completely in the wrong direction” on both delivery dates and price, an outcome he described as unacceptable.

The STAR Plan: New Capabilities In Sight For The Belgian Navy
Naval News – Belgium is about to increase its defense budget significantly. The country’s Parliament recently adopted a revised version of the military planning law (loi de programmation militaire, LPM) which includes an extra 11.7 billion Euros, among which a minority part is devoted to the Belgian Navy.

Belgian Navy – Leopold I Leaves for Lebanon
Defense Technology International – Leopold I Leaves for Lebanon
The Belgian frigate Leopold I will be the flagship of the UN Interim Force In Lebanon Maritime Task Force (UNIFIL MTF) between 1 March and 31 May. The Leopold I will leave the Belgian port of Zeebrugge on 16 February to relieve the French frigate De Grasse, the current flagship of the UNIFIL MTF.
